The suffix ".part04.rar" indicates that the original data, likely named "Dragon3dNest-alE13" (suggesting a 3D model of a dragon, perhaps part of a "Nest" project), has been divided into multiple smaller files to facilitate easier downloading, sharing, or archiving [1]. The number "04" implies that this is the fourth part of an archive containing at least four, and potentially more, segments. To reconstruct the original file and utilize the contents, all segments (part01, part02, part03, part04, etc.) must be present in the same directory, allowing archive software like WinRAR or 7-Zip to reassemble them seamlessly [1].
